A Brief History of Transparency in Fashion

The concept of sheer clothing isn't new. On the flip side, the acceptance and interpretation of transparency have always been deeply intertwined with societal norms and moral codes. On the flip side, from ancient Grecian chitons to Victorian-era lingerie, the degree of transparency and its social implications have varied considerably. Which means in the early 20th century, the flapper era saw a rise in sheer fabrics, challenging traditional Victorian modesty. Throughout history, various cultures have utilized transparent fabrics for different purposes. The level of acceptable transparency fluctuated dramatically throughout history, reflecting the prevailing cultural attitudes towards sexuality and the female body.

The modern iteration of see-through dresses often incorporates delicate fabrics like lace, chiffon, or mesh, sometimes layered to create a carefully calculated effect. This contemporary approach can range from subtly revealing to overtly provocative, depending on the design, the wearer's intent, and the overall context.

The Intention Behind the Choice: Conscious vs. Unconscious Decisions

Understanding the intention behind wearing a see-through dress is crucial. The intention drastically impacts the public's interpretation. Day to day, is it a deliberate fashion statement, a form of self-expression, or perhaps an unintentional oversight? Consider this: a carefully styled outfit, accessorized to balance the transparency, might be viewed as a confident and artistic choice. Conversely, a garment worn without consideration for context or potential public perception might be interpreted negatively.

Consider the following scenarios:

  • The Fashion-Forward Individual: A woman attending a fashion event might wear a see-through gown as a bold statement, aligning with the event's theme and the overall fashion culture present. In this context, the dress is an expected and accepted aspect of the occasion.

  • The Unknowing Individual: Someone might unintentionally wear a garment that becomes transparent due to inadequate lighting or unexpected circumstances. This scenario is distinct from a deliberate fashion choice, and judgment should be tempered with understanding.

  • The Provocateur: In certain situations, a see-through dress might be worn with the explicit intention of causing a reaction or challenging social norms. This is a form of performance art, using clothing as a medium of self-expression.

Societal Expectations and the Role of Context

Public perception of see-through dresses is heavily influenced by societal expectations and the specific context. A dress deemed appropriate at a fashion show might be considered highly inappropriate at a religious ceremony or a professional meeting. The setting significantly alters the interpretation of the clothing choice.

To build on this, societal expectations are not static; they are fluid and evolve over time. Plus, what might have been considered scandalous a few decades ago might be commonplace today. These shifts reflect changing cultural attitudes toward body image, sexuality, and freedom of expression.

Different cultures also have varying interpretations of acceptable public attire. Here's the thing — what might be considered modest in one culture could be seen as revealing in another. This highlights the importance of cultural sensitivity and awareness when discussing the appropriateness of see-through clothing in public spaces.

Legal Considerations and Public Decency Laws

While freedom of expression is a fundamental right, it's not absolute. Laws related to public decency and indecency vary significantly between jurisdictions. These laws often address issues of nudity, obscenity, and behavior deemed disruptive to public order. Whether a see-through dress violates these laws depends on the specifics of the garment, the context, and the interpretation of the relevant legislation.

make sure to note that the legal threshold for what constitutes indecent exposure is often ambiguous and subject to interpretation by law enforcement and the courts. The line between artistic expression and public indecency can be blurry and often depends on factors such as the location, time of day, and the presence of children. Which means, individuals should exercise caution and consider the potential legal consequences before wearing overtly revealing clothing in public.

The Role of the Media and Social Perception

The media plays a significant role in shaping public perception of see-through dresses and similar fashion choices. Media portrayals often reinforce existing societal norms or challenge them, influencing how individuals perceive and react to such garments. Sensationalist coverage can exacerbate existing divisions and fuel negative judgements, while balanced and nuanced reporting can contribute to a more constructive understanding of the issue.

Social media further complicates the issue, providing platforms for both positive and negative reactions. Online shaming and body-shaming can have significant negative consequences for individuals, highlighting the need for responsible online behavior and a commitment to respectful dialogue.
